Arkhangelsk-based Northern Shipping Company (NOSCO) has started up a dedicated Arkhangelsk- Moscow container train, together with the Commercial Seaport of Arkhangelsk and Russian Railways. Transit time (one way) is slated at 2-3 days, compared to 7-8 days for standard freight trains. Capacity is understood to be 42 x 60ft flats (126 TEU) and frequency is two pairs/month, although NOSCO plans to double frequency to weekly.
